Output 25cbb18cba069f5336644582fb7c2223ea164b410074dfda9ed5644ee6fb0d7e:0

value
86927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f6417d179ab786a68668968925e9960fd3b7158 OP_EQUAL
address
3LbbhqceGG5YT7Mb1MNUZoPJ3pSexutbP7
transaction
25cbb18cba069f5336644582fb7c2223ea164b410074dfda9ed5644ee6fb0d7e
confirmations
215573
spent
true